The Christian Family Movement (CFM) is a network of small family groups, ideally but not necessarily parish- based. Groups often consist of 3 to 8 families, which may include couples, single parents, widows, widowers and individuals, who seek to become true family communities and work together to promote mutual growth. Founded in the 1950s, the CFM is the first organization that encourages small family groups to pray and do good works together.
” Our mission is to evangelize families and communities in Asia who shall grow in the love of God and neighbor through prayers, family programs and services, as proclaimed by the Gospel and guided by the teachings of the Catholic Church.”
